/
Outline.pm6
29 lines (21 loc) · 1.11 KB
/
Outline.pm6
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
use v6;
# generated by: ../../etc/make-modules.p6 --role-name=ISO_32000::Outline ../../resources/ISO_32000/Outline_entries.json
#| PDF 32000-1:2008 Table 152 – Entries in the outline dictionary
role ISO_32000::Outline {
method Type {...};
method First {...};
method Last {...};
method Count {...};
}
=begin pod
=head1 Methods (Entries)
=head2 Type [name]
- (Optional) The type of PDF object that this dictionary describes; if present, is Outlines for an outline dictionary.
=head2 First [dictionary]
- (Required if there are any open or closed outline entries; is an indirect reference) An outline item dictionary representing the first top-level item in the outline.
=head2 Last [dictionary]
- (Required if there are any open or closed outline entries; is an indirect reference) An outline item dictionary representing the last top-level item in the outline.
=head2 Count [integer]
- (Required if the document has any open outline entries) Total number of visible outline items at all levels of the outline. The value cannot be negative.
This entry is omitted if there are no open outline items.
=end pod